please help! i'll give you a cookie c; What is the value of the expression 7^-3 A. -21 B. -1/343 C. 1/343 D. 343
what is \(7^{-3}=\) property of exponents you need to remember: \[x^{-a} = \frac{1}{x^{a}}\] and \[\frac{1}{x^{-a}} = x^a\]
